Book Description
In a hair-raising adventure story that takes place hundreds of miles beneath the earth's surface, two explorers come upon the savage, primordial realm of Pellucidar. There, encountering primitive humans led by their beautiful, courageous queen, Dian, they resolve to help her people in a desperate struggle against their dreaded reptilian masters.
